Detoxification - Wyomissing

Individuals who are physically reliant to drugs or alcohol and want help will initially go through detoxification before receiving other treatment services in drug rehab. Detox is basically the procedure of the drug being eradicated from one's system, which is typically uncomfortable and may carry risks if not executed in a setting which can provide appropriate support and medical intervention as required. Detoxification services are offered at either a professional drug or alcohol detox facility or a drug treatment facility which can effectively oversee and present medical supervision for men and women who are just coming off of drugs. Detoxification services frequently include insuring the individual is as comfortable as possible while detoxing and going through drug or alcohol withdrawal, providing proper nutrition and making certain the particular person is receiving proper rest, and providing supplements and medicine as wanted to make the detox process as easy and safe as possible. The person in detoxification will sometimes be encouraged to take part in some form of physical activity such as walking, yoga, etc. At a drug detoxification facility or drug treatment facility which can present detoxification services, the person will have detoxification staff at their disposal around the clock to assure that any issues are fixed as quickly and safely as possible.
